After making up an interleaved set of … Webb"The volumes of the Musical museum as originally published, were mbly dedicated to the Catch club, instituted at Edinburgh June 1771.' On the completion of the sixth and last volume, in1803, Johnson substituted a new set of title-pages, dedicationg the work the Society of Antiquaries of Scotland.'" (Laing's pref. to 1839 ed., v. 1, p.ii, foot-note)

The Scots Musical Museum is one of the canonical texts in the formation of what we now think of as the Scottish song tradition. It also lies at the heart of the question: what is the Burns canon? Until the 1960s, Burns was credited with the authorship of an increasing number of songs in the …

WebbThe Scots Musical Museum was an influential collection of traditional folk music of Scotland published from 1787 to 1803. While it was not the first collection of Scottish folk songs and music, the six volumes with 100 songs in each collected many pieces, introduced new songs, and brought many of them into the classical music repertoire.
